What is Praluent used for?
- Heterozygous familial hypercholesterolemia
- Clinical ASCVD
- Statin-intolerant patients
02
Alirocumab side effects
Common side effects of Alirocumab include:
Injection site reactions
Nasopharyngitis
Influenza-like illness
Myalgia
